Job Details
Adult and pediatric burn trauma surgical ICU RN. Primary RN Care model. Nursing care ratios 1:2 for critical care patients. 1:1 nursing care support for burn trauma code 1 admissions and high acuity and post-operative patients.Needs include invasive hemodynamic monitoring (At least Q 1 hr), IV drip titration, nurse driven burn fluid resuscitation following Parkland formula, ventilator management, CVVH, Q 1 h pulse and flap doppler checks, initial debridement and dressing changes, conscious sedation, surgical recovery, epidural pumps.
